DIY Roof Inspection Tips

While it’s essential to hire professionals for thorough roof inspections, you can perform some basic checks yourself. Here are some DIY roof inspection tips:

  1. Safety Precautions

Before inspecting your roof, prioritize safety. Use a sturdy ladder and wear appropriate footwear with good traction. Avoid inspecting the roof during unfavorable weather conditions.

  1. Checking for Roof Damage

Carefully examine your roof for any signs of damage, such as missing or damaged shingles, cracks, or gaps in the roofing material. Pay attention to the flashing around chimneys, vents, and skylights.

  1. Clearing Debris and Gutters

Regularly clean your gutters and remove any debris that has accumulated on your roof. Clogged gutters can lead to water backup and potential damage to your roof.

  1. Addressing Minor Issues

If you notice any minor damage or issues during your inspection, address them promptly. Replace missing shingles, seal gaps, and repair small leaks using appropriate materials.

Common Roof Maintenance Practices

Regular roof maintenance is vital for preserving its integrity and functionality. Here are some common maintenance practices:

  • Regular Cleaning

Regularly cleaning your roof, removing debris, and keeping it free from moss or algae growth can prevent moisture retention and extend its lifespan.

  • Repairing or Replacing Damaged Shingles

Promptly replace any damaged or missing shingles to prevent water leaks and further damage to your roof structure.

  • Sealing Gaps and Leaks

Identify and seal any gaps, cracks, or leaks to maintain the integrity of your roof. Use appropriate sealants and materials recommended for your roofing type.

  • Inspecting and Maintaining Flashing

Flashing around chimneys, vents, and other roof penetrations should be inspected and maintained regularly. Damaged or deteriorated flashing can result in leaks and water damage.

Roof Maintenance Checklist

To ensure comprehensive roof maintenance, consider the following checklist:

  • – Trim overhanging branches to prevent damage caused by falling limbs.
  • – Keep your gutters clean and free from debris to avoid water backup and potential roof damage.
  • – Regularly remove any debris that accumulates on your roof, such as leaves, twigs, or branches.
  • – Inspect your attic and ceiling for any signs of water stains or mold growth, indicating potential roof leaks or ventilation issues.
